Healthcare providers must enhance network visibility to detect threats, prevent breaches, and ensure HIPAA compliance.

Cyberattacks on healthcare organizations are increasing, with patient data being a prime target. Hackers use stolen medical records for identity theft, insurance fraud, and financial crimes. A data breach not only leads to financial losses but also damages patient trust and disrupts medical operations.

To prevent such risks, hospitals and healthcare providers must improve network visibility. This means having a clear, real-time view of all network activity, allowing IT teams to spot unusual behavior, detect threats early, and secure patient information. Strong network monitoring also helps healthcare organizations follow legal requirements, such as HIPAA, while keeping systems running smoothly.

Growing Cyber Threats in Healthcare

More hospitals now rely on cloud-based medical records, connected devices, and telemedicine. While these technologies improve patient care, they also create new security risks. Hackers often target healthcare networks because they hold valuable patient information and may have weak defenses.

Studies show that healthcare data breaches cost organizations millions per incident. Attackers often move through networks undetected for months, stealing data without triggering alarms. Without proper network visibility, healthcare providers struggle to identify and stop these hidden threats.

How Network Visibility Helps Protect Patient Data

1. Detecting Cyber Threats Faster
A clear view of network traffic allows IT teams to detect and stop cyberattacks before they cause harm. Unusual activity—such as large data transfers, access from unknown locations, or suspicious logins—can signal a breach. Real-time alerts help security teams respond quickly and minimize damage.

2. Stopping Insider Threats and Unauthorized Access
Not all data breaches come from external hackers. Employees or contractors may accidentally expose patient records or intentionally misuse sensitive data. Network monitoring tools track who is accessing what information and when, helping to detect suspicious activity before it becomes a serious problem.

3. Meeting HIPAA and Other Compliance Standards
Healthcare providers must follow strict rules, like HIPAA, to protect patient data. A strong network monitoring system helps meet these standards by:


  • Tracking and logging data access for audits
  • Sending alerts on unauthorized activity
  • Ensuring encryption and security protocols are in place

  • With detailed reports and real-time insights, healthcare organizations can prove compliance and avoid costly fines.

    4. Securing Medical Devices from Cyber Threats
    Many healthcare facilities use connected medical devices such as smart monitors, infusion pumps, and imaging machines. However, these devices lack strong security features, making them easy targets for cyberattacks. Network visibility tools monitor these devices, detecting unusual behavior, unauthorized access, or malware infections before they affect patient care.

    5. Preventing Downtime and Disruptions
    Cyberattacks can shut down hospital networks, delaying treatments and surgeries. With real-time monitoring, IT teams can:

  • Quickly isolate infected systems to stop the spread of malware
  • Reduce response time by detecting threats earlier
  • Ensure continuous access to critical patient records

  • By improving network visibility, hospitals can maintain smooth operations and protect patient safety.
